Introduction to Division

Division is a fundamental arithmetic operation that involves splitting a number into equal parts or groups. It is the process of determining how many times one number is contained within another. In Spanish, division is called división, and understanding this concept is essential for solving math problems involving sharing or grouping quantities equally.

Terms in Division

Key terms used in division include the dividend (el dividendo), the divisor (el divisor), and the quotient (el cociente). The dividend is the number you want to divide, the divisor is the number you divide by, and the quotient is the result of the division.

Division Vocabulary in Spanish

When teaching or learning division in Spanish, it's important to know related vocabulary words such as resto (remainder), dividir (to divide), parte iguales (equal parts), and cociente exacto (exact quotient). These terms help express the division process clearly.

Representing Division

Division can be expressed with different symbols or words. In Spanish, the division symbol ÷ is known as signo de división, and division can also be indicated by phrases like "dividido por" or "entre" connecting numbers in a division sentence.

Practical Examples

Practical examples help students understand division conceptually. For example, dividing 12 by 3 is expressed as 12 ÷ 3 = 4, and in Spanish, "doce dividido por tres es igual a cuatro." Using everyday scenarios such as sharing candies or distributing objects helps reinforce these ideas.
